6. Voice selection *Non-GM1*
6-1. Voice Selection Procedure
The XG voice selection procedure is as follows.
Melody voice Bank Select MSB = 00H,
use Bank Select LSB to specify the bank,
then use Program Change to select the voice
SFX voice Bank Select MSB = 40H,
Bank Select LSB = 00H (fixed),
then use Program Change to select the voice
SFX kit Bank Select MSB = 7EH,
Bank Select LSB = 00H (fixed),
then use Program Change to select the kit,
finally, use Note Number to select the voice
Rhythm Kit Bank Select MSB = 7FH,
Bank Select LSB = 00H (fixed),
then use Program Change to select the kit,
finally, use Note Number to select the voice
For Kit and Voice mapping, refer to the “XG Voice List” and “XG Drum List” that are attached to
the XG Specifications. In the SFX kit, there are some notes within the valid range of notes that
produce no sound (that is, keys to which no voice is assigned).
6-2. Melody Voice Substitution
Tone generators that do not have the specified bank when a new melody voice is selected will
automatically substitute the sound of the previously selected bank. (By default, this will be the GM
basic sound set in Bank 0.)
As an example:
If you want Bank Select
MSB = 00H, LSB = 2DH, Program Change #29 Jazz Man
but a substitution of
MSB = 00H, LSB = 2BH, Program Change #29 Funk Gtr 2
is possible, first transmit
MSB = 00H, LSB = 2BH, Program Change #29
and then transmit
MSB = 00H, LSB = 2DH, Program Change #29
This slight detour will minimize the chances of an undesired replacement by the GM basic sound
set.
